KCR Insulted Constitution By Restricting Republic Day Celebrations: Revanth Reddy

Hyderabad, Jan 26 (Maxim News): Telangana Pradesh Congress Committee (TPCC) President and MP, Revanth Reddy said that Chief Minister K.Chandrasekhar Rao (KCR) has insulted the Constitution written by Dr. B.R Ambedkar by restricting Republic Day celebrations to Raj Bhavan and Pragati Bhavan. He said if there is a difference between the Governor and the Chief Minister, it should be presented on another platform.

It is not good to make the Republic Day celebration a platform for differences between the two. KCR should change its business style. He demanded the KCR should apologize to Governor Dr. Tamilisai Soundara Rajan. He questioned whether the Court has to intervene in holding Republic Day Celebration, this has been included in the history of Independent India, he pointed out.

Participating in the Republic Day celebrations by unveiling the National Flag at Gandhi Bhavan, today, Revanth Reddy said that if MLAs defect from the party, there is a need to cancel their membership and hang them if necessary. The punishment should be on par with the sections of murders which should be applied to party defectors. There is a need to take a tough decision on party defections. Intellectuals should think about bringing an amendment to the Constitution on this issue.

Revanth Reddy said that senior All India Congress leader Rahul Gandhi will unfurl the National flag in Kashmir and declare the country’s sovereignty. On that day worship should be done in the prayer halls of all religions. Hath-se-Hath jodo Yatra officially started today, it will continue for 60 days from February 6 covering as many constituencies as possible.

People of Telangana should bless the Congress party and take it forward. There is a conspiracy to take reservations away from the poor. It is our responsibility to reverse this conspiracy. They (BJP) overthrew nine governments and made a mockery of the constitution said Revanth Reddy. (Munsif News)
